LEADERSHIP REVIEW BRIEFING — Board of Orvale Logistics

The Q2 cash-flow forecast shows operating inflows up 6% on the Tarnbeck route expansion, offset by fleet maintenance costs. Liquidity remains within covenant thresholds through September. Management recommends deferring the Ellsmere depot purchase to Q4. A confidential note on related strategic plans is appended below for board members only.

board note of tadup-tajog: Headcount on the Oliiel team goes from 31 to 88 by the end of February. Gross margin on Oliiel came in at 62 percent against a plan of 29 percent.

## Deployment

Heads up, future maintainers: the revamped password reset flow for Quillgate ships as its own service now, so deploys are decoupled from the main auth monolith. Roll it out with the usual blue-green dance — drain old pods, flip the router, watch the reset-success dashboard for ten minutes. Rollback is just flipping the router back. Before you deploy anywhere, double-check that your environment matches the expected configuration values below:

service settings:
[eliax]
port = 6379
region = lower-4
host = eliax.paliqlabs.corp
timeout_ms = 750
retries = 3

**Ticket CAT-providence: Expired credential broke catalog cache invalidation**

The Mersiway catalog cache stopped invalidating on Tuesday because the `cache-bust` service credential expired silently. Stale prices persisted for roughly six hours before the Orvane dashboard flagged drift. Please verify TTLs are honored after redeploy, and confirm the purge worker reconnects cleanly. A fresh key for the internal purge API has been issued and is included below.

gateway credential: kto23_dolYgAScEh2TaPOlStqOl98

/*
 * RestockPilot client setup — for external plugin authors.
 * This client talks to the Corridor restock-planning API: it pulls
 * machine inventory snapshots, predicts sell-through, and returns a
 * suggested restock route. Plugins must call init() before any
 * planner methods. Rate limit: 60 req/min per plugin. Sandbox data
 * only; production machines are off-limits. Initialize the client
 * with the key below.
 */

API key for bahop-yajog: qvz3-mhf